Awkward laughter is a fascinating phenomenon that often occurs in uncomfortable or socially awkward situations. While it may seem counterintuitive for laughter to arise from discomfort, it serves as a unique social tool. This unexpected reaction can help to diffuse tension and signal to others that one is not a threat. Psychologists suggest that awkward laughter aids in establishing group cohesion, allowing individuals to temporarily bond over shared discomfort. The brain releases endorphins during this process, which can create a sense of relief and even happiness, ultimately making us feel good despite the awkwardness of the moment.
Moreover, the science behind awkward laughter reveals that it is deeply rooted in human psychology. When faced with social discomfort, our brain's fight-or-flight response can trigger laughter as a means of coping. This involuntary reaction is often accompanied by physiological changes such as increased heart rate and heightened awareness. Interestingly, similar to the contagious nature of traditional laughter, awkward laughter can spread through social interactions, fostering a sense of unity among those witnessing the situation. The paradox of finding joy in awkwardness highlights our innate desire for connection and understanding in even the most uncomfortable circumstances.

Awkward humor has often been perceived as a quirky way to ease tension and break the ice in social situations. Recent research suggests that this type of humor can actually play a significant role in fostering genuine connections between individuals. By embracing the uncomfortable moments and using humor to navigate them, people may find that they relate to each other on a deeper level. Awkward humor acts as a social lubricant that encourages vulnerability, allowing individuals to share their imperfections and feelings more openly, which in turn builds trust.
Furthermore, studies indicate that individuals who share awkward humor tend to exhibit greater levels of empathy and understanding towards one another. This shared experience not only creates a sense of camaraderie but also helps individuals bond over the recognition of their own social faux pas. Genuine connection thrives on authenticity, and awkward moments, when acknowledged with humor, pave the way for more meaningful interactions.
